The College of Arts and Media (CAM) seeks a dynamic and creative student who aspires to be anevent and lifestyle photography professional. The Photography Intern supports the CAM Marketing and Communications Team by creating photo elements for marketing campaigns that increase the visibility and awareness of department productions, exhibitions, and performances.
The CAM Marketing and Communications Team allows student interns to work professionally and gain valuable real-world skills and training to benefit their future careers. This intern will report to the CAM Marketing and Communications Team leader, the Director of Strategic Initiatives and Operations.
Duties and ExpectationsThis position is a representative of the college and university and requires serious dedication to the internship.

  • Collaborate with the team to produce marketing images for CAM
  • Attend events/performances/exhibitions/rehearsals to capture photo content – this will include nights and weekends
  • Capture and maintain stock photos for the college and departments
  • Focus on campus life photography around the departments for publications as well as social media postings
  • Portrait photography for departments as needed
  • Other projects as assigned

Preferred Qualifications
  • Expert knowledge of Adobe Photoshop or Lightroom
  • Working knowledge of photography equipment. (Office provided equipment is Canon, or you may use your own.)
  • Working knowledge of photo size requirements for digital formats such as social media platforms and print formats
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ills
  • Capable of handling a fast-paced marketing environment
  • Creative and extroverted personality with a passion for arts and media
